Question : If $\cos\theta = \frac{35}{37}$, then what is the value of $\cot \theta$?

Option 1: $\frac{12}{35}$

Option 2: $\frac{35}{12}$

Option 3: $\frac{37}{12}$

Option 4: $\frac{12}{37}$

Team Careers360 15th Jan, 2024

Correct Answer: $\frac{35}{12}$


Solution : Given: $\cos \theta = \frac{35}{37}$,
$\cos\theta = \frac{\text{Base}}{\text{Hypotenuse}}$
Let base = 35k and hypotenuse = 37k

Using Pythagoras theorem,
$AB =\sqrt{(37k)^{2}-(35k)^{2}} = 12k$
$\therefore\cot \theta = \frac{\text{Base}}{\text{Perpendicular}}$ = $\frac{35}{12}$
Hence, the correct answer is $\frac{35}{12}$.
